BMS, EPMS, DCIM - all the acronyms but still no clear visibility?
The modern data center software stack is often built around overlapping platforms:
- Building Management Systems (BMS)
- Electrical Power Monitoring Systems (EPMS)
- Data Center Infrastructure Management (DCIM)
These systems frequently share devices, dashboards, and telemetry. Operators often see the same alarms, electrical one-lines, UPS metrics, generator data, temperature readings, and power trends replicated across multiple tools. While each platform serves an important operational purpose, they largely function as systems of record rather than systems of understanding.
And that creates a challenge.
If multiple platforms are showing the same infrastructure monitoring data, are you actually gaining deeper operational insight—or simply duplicating?
